mirror of
https://github.com/opencv/opencv.git
synced 2025-06-11 11:45:30 +08:00
Fixed crash in BruteForceMatcher::clone
This commit is contained in:
parent
43628ab868
commit
6935e95c2a
@ -2367,6 +2367,7 @@ Ptr<DescriptorMatcher> BruteForceMatcher<Distance>::clone( bool emptyTrainData )
|
|||||||
BruteForceMatcher* matcher = new BruteForceMatcher(distance);
|
BruteForceMatcher* matcher = new BruteForceMatcher(distance);
|
||||||
if( !emptyTrainData )
|
if( !emptyTrainData )
|
||||||
{
|
{
|
||||||
|
matcher->trainDescCollection.resize(trainDescCollection.size());
|
||||||
std::transform( trainDescCollection.begin(), trainDescCollection.end(),
|
std::transform( trainDescCollection.begin(), trainDescCollection.end(),
|
||||||
matcher->trainDescCollection.begin(), clone_op );
|
matcher->trainDescCollection.begin(), clone_op );
|
||||||
}
|
}
|
||||||
|
Loading…
Reference in New Issue
Block a user